Nashi Pear and Pomegranate Salad

The Nashi pear comes from Japan and Nashi actually means pear, so it is a pear pear! It is very juicy and tastes like a mixture of apple and pear. I like them a lot! I made a very juicy salad with it. Green lettuce, light yellow pear, and red pomegranate seeds, a burst of color. Add a fine ginger honey dressing, a delicious meal!

Deliciously unusual!
Prep time
15 min
Cooking time
0 min
Portions
4
Total time
15 min

Ingredients

  • Green Lettuce Leaves

  • 2-3 Nashi Pears

  • 1 Pomegranate, the seeds

  • diced Cheese (you can use Feta)

  • 1 Handful Olives

  • Dressing:

  • 100 ml Olive Oil

  • 2 tbsp Vinegar

  • 1 tbsp Mustard

  • 1 tbsp Hony

  • 1-2 tsp grated Ginger

  • Salt and Pepper

Instructions

1

Step 1

Chop the lettuce leaves and put them in a bowl.
2

Step 2

Cut the nashi pears into quarters, remove the seeds and cut the quarters into thin slices. Place them on top of the green salad.
3

Step 3

Add the olives, the cheese cubes, and the pomegranate seeds.
4

Step 4

Mix the ingredients of the dressing well and pour on top. Serve!
